Detailed explanation-1: -As a result, the moon’s eastward orbit around the earth takes 27.32 days. This is known as the moon’s sidereal month, which is the time it takes for the moon to complete a full orbit around the earth with respect to returning to the same place among the stars.

Detailed explanation-2: -plural sidereal months. : the mean time of the moon’s revolution in its orbit with reference to a star’s position : 27 days, 7 hours, 43 minutes, 11.5 seconds of mean time. The Moon rotates on its axis once every 27.32166 days.

Detailed explanation-3: -The synodic lunar month is defined by the visible phases of the Moon. The length of a synodic lunar month ranges from 29.18 days to 29.93 days. The sidereal lunar month is defined by the Moon’s orbit with respect to the stars.

Detailed explanation-4: -It takes 27 days, 7 hours, and 43 minutes for our Moon to complete one full orbit around Earth. This is called the sidereal month, and is measured by our Moon’s position relative to distant “fixed” stars.
